Washington faced four major problems by assuming the role of president. These were: organizing the new government and establishing his cabinet; pulling the nation out of serious financial problems; obtaining a better relationship with Great Britain; and negotiating treaties of friendship with the Indian tribes. Washington successfully achieved solutions to each of these problems during his administration. </span>
